The Pioneer 50 BLUETTI AC60 costs $599 for 403Wh; the DJI Power 500 costs $359 for 512Wh. DJI is both the bigger battery and the cheaper one — 109Wh more capacity for $240 less — a combination that almost never happens in this category.

DJI keeps winning past capacity: 1,000W continuous output against the Pioneer 50's 600W, 4,000 rated cycles against 3,000, 25dB against 45 under load, and 16.1 lbs against 20.06. None of these are close calls.

The Pioneer 50 answers with exactly one structural advantage, but it's a real one: it accepts BLUETTI's expansion batteries, growing into a multi-kilowatt-hour bank without replacing the base unit. DJI has no expansion ecosystem for any of its power stations yet. That's the whole argument for the Pioneer 50, and whether it's worth $240 depends entirely on whether you'll actually use it.

Runtime model

Runtime = (rated capacity × 0.85 inverter efficiency) ÷ device wattage. Solar recharge estimates assume panels deliver 70% of rated output. Cold weather, battery age, and stacked loads reduce real-world results.

Power Score

Computed from 14 published spec dimensions, weighted per use-case bench. Higher is better; a unit must meet a bench's minimum threshold to be rated.

Brand trust

BLUETTI

Ecosystem

One of the broadest lineups — 15-20+ models from budget (AC2A) to flagship (Apex 300, 3072Wh). Includes specialized products: vehicle solar hubs, sodium-ion cold-weather units, and balcony storage systems.

Support

The most inconsistent support in the space. Heavily email-based with China timezone delays. Some users get smooth, efficient service; others report weeks of troubleshooting runarounds, being offered discounts on new units instead of repairs, and confusing third-party purchase claim processes. Buying direct from Bluetti's website tends to produce better support outcomes.

DJI

Ecosystem

New entrant (2024) — 4 power station models: Power 500, Power 1000 V2, Power 1000 Mini, Power 2000

Support

Leveraging DJI's established global support and repair center network from the drone business. Generally positive reputation inherited from drone operations, but limited power-station-specific track record.

Community

No dedicated power station community yet. Discussions happen within r/dji (~250K members, mostly drone users). Very small power-specific presence on Facebook and forums.

App experience

Rated 3.5/5 iOS and Android (DJI Home app ratings reflect entire DJI ecosystem including drones/cameras, not power-station-specific). Users report the on-device screen is more reliable than the app.

Unique strength

DJI brings hundreds of battery patents from its drone business and builds some of the quietest units in the category, with fast wall-charging speeds inherited from that same engineering focus.

Worth knowing

DJI is a new entrant to power stations with only about two years of track record and no expansion ecosystem yet, so there's less field history to lean on than with an established brand.

Don't read the Pioneer 50 BLUETTI AC60's expandability as a straight win here: it starts at 403Wh, below the Power 500's 512Wh, so a first expansion battery largely buys back capacity the Power 500 already includes. It only pulls ahead if you'd grow past 512Wh — short of that, the Power 500's larger fixed capacity is the simpler value.
